PRODUCT DESCRIPTION:
Cefpodoxime is an advanced third-generation cephalosporin antibiotic designed for oral administration.
It exhibits broad-spectrum bactericidal activity by inhibiting bacterial cell wall synthesis and is stable against many β-lactamase–producing strains, making it a potent agent against both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ria.
It is well-absorbed from the GI tract and demonstrates excellent clinical efficacy in the treatment of respiratory, skin, urinary, and ENT infections.
Cefpodoxime Tablets & Dry Syrup are preferred for their safety profile, rapid onset, and convenient oral dosing, especially in outpatient and step-down therapy settings.

Therapeutic Indications:
- Community-acquired Pneumonia
- Acute Tonsillitis & Pharyngitis
- Sinusitis
- Otitis Media
- Urinary Tract Infections
- Skin & Soft Tissue Infections
- Gonorrhea (uncomplicated)
- Typhoid Fever
- Lower Respiratory Tract Infections (including bronchitis)
Side Effects:
- COMMON:
- Nausea
- Diarrhea
- Abdominal discomfort
- Headache
- Mild rash or pruritus
- SERIOUS (RARE):
- Hypersensitivity reactions including anaphylaxis
- Clostridioides difficile–associated diarrhea
- Hepatotoxicity
- Stevens-Johnson Syndrome
- Blood dyscrasias (e.g., neutropenia, eosinophilia)
- PRECAUTIONS:
- Caution in patients allergic to cephalosporins or penicillins
- Dose adjustment may be required in renal impairment
- Not recommended for infants under 2 months of age
- Use during pregnancy only if clearly needed
Monitor liver enzymes during long-term therapy
